Is a spring balance a newton meter?
A spring balance (or newton meter) is a type of weighing scale. They are commonly used to measure the force exerted on an object. This force is usually measured in Newtons and is essentially the weight of an object. The weight of an object is a measurement of its mass x gravity (W=mg).

What does a spring balance do?
Mass, force, and torque measurement Spring balances provide a method of mass measurement that is both simple and cheap. The mass is hung on the end of a spring and the deflection of the spring due to the downwards gravitational force on the mass is measured against a scale.
How does a calibrated Newton spring balance work?
Well it is a Newton spring balance. The calibrated spring provides a measure of the force applied to the balance. The larger the force, the more the spring extends with the force level indicated by the scale on the balance.
